  • blocks aren't well understood at all outside of the Okinawan karate community. You don't block to prevent getting hit, you block to hurt your opponent's arm or leg, throw their balance off and not get hit. I've taken out several kickboxers because they would hurt their legs on my forearm and elbow. At any rate, blocks aren't always blocks. You can knock an opponent's guard out of the way for your strike as well. They're just so much versatile than the way they're taught and trained.

  • The problem with karate is, that many instructors are just students themselves, who can not be bothered to learn for 10+ years to get any good skill in the art and there for lack the final understanding. In many TMAs instructors give you basic, incomplete techniques at the beginning so those that are not true in their journey for knowledge shall drop out. Only after several years will you be given in-depth detail of techniques and real-life applications. That's why we have so many bad "masters"
